What Key Natural Oils Are Common in Handmade Skincare Products?

Collection of natural oils in elegant bottles with source ingredients

In handmade skincare, several natural oils stand out for their beneficial properties. These include:

  • Jojoba Oil: Effective for moisturizing and balancing skin oil production.

  • Coconut Oil: Renowned for its antibacterial properties and deep hydration.

  • Argan Oil: Packed with essential fatty acids that nourish and protect the skin.

  • Rosehip Seed Oil: Rich in antioxidants, it aids in skin regeneration and healing.

These oils are often chosen for their ability to nourish, hydrate, and rejuvenate the skin without the negative effects associated with synthetic ingredients.

Which Synthetic Chemicals Are Commonly Found in Mass-Produced Skincare?

Several harmful synthetic chemicals are commonly present in commercial skincare products. These may include:

  1. Parabens: Preservatives linked to hormonal disruptions.

  2. Sulfates: Cleaning agents that can strip skin of natural oils.

  3. Fragrance additives: Often allergy-inducing and can cause skin irritation.

  4. Phthalates: Chemicals used to increase flexibility in products, associated with reproductive and developmental harm.

These additives can lead to a variety of adverse skin reactions, illustrating the importance of scrutinizing skincare product ingredients.

Natural Ingredient Benefits: The Power of Bioactive Botanicals in Skincare

Lentinula edodes(Shiitake) has been traditionally used in East Asian medicine for its immunomodulatory and skin-health benefits. Among its bioactive constituents, ergosterol— a provitamin D₂ precursor— plays an important role in maintaining skin homeostasis. In this study, we investigated the ability of an oil-soluble extract fromLentinula edodes(SMosE) to modulate vitamin D receptor (VDR)–dependent transcription and influence key biological processes involved in skin barrier integrity, hydration, wound repair, and sebum regulation, supporting its relevance for dermatological applications. Lentinula edodes (Shiitake) extract as a vitamin D receptor activator to enhance skin adaptogenic responses, 2026
